UP'S HIT REALITY SERIES "BRINGING UP BATES" RETURNS WITH 14 ALL-NEW EPISODES, BEGINNING ON THURSDAY, JUNE 4

Michaella & Brandon's Engagement, Erin's Challenging First Pregnancy and Joyful Birth of Carson, the Birth of Alyssa & John's First Child, Allie Jane, Dollywood and More Are Featured in Supersized All-New Season

ATLANTA - June 1, 2015 - UP, the network for feel good TV for you and your family, presents the return of the hit UP Original Series "Bringing Up Bates," which takes a fresh look at a loving American family with 19 children and larger-than-life personalities, for an all-new season. The series returns for its second season with 14 all-new episodes exclusively on UP, starting this Thursday, June 4 at 9 p.m. EDT.

Highlights this season include Brandon's romantic engagement to Michaella in Washington, D.C. and the couple's plans leading into their just-announced August 15th wedding in Knoxville, TN; dramatic milestones in Erin's challenging first pregnancy and joyful birth of baby Carson; the birth of Alyssa & John's first child, Allie Jane, in Orlando, FL; the family's unique, annual "I Love You Day" celebration; a fun-filled annual family trip to the lake; Addee and Ellie's joint birthday pool party; and a joyful season finale, featuring the family's singing debut at Dolly Parton's Dollywood!

Descriptions for the first four episodes of the season are as follows:

Thursday, June 4 at 9 p.m. EDT "Bringing Up Bates" Episode 201 - "All Together Again" (1-hour episode) In the season two premiere, the family celebrates their special tradition, "I Love You Day," with surprise gifts (and surprise guests) for the whole family. Gil, Kelly Jo and the couples go out on a quintuple date and everyone joins together to prepare for Alyssa's baby shower!

Thursday, June 11 at 9 p.m. EDT "Bringing Up Bates" Episode 202 - "Future In-Laws" Gil, Kelly Jo and Michael head to Chicago to see Brandon's parents. Brandon corners Gil for a "heart to heart" talk in the most unlikely of places! Meanwhile, back in Tennessee, Erin and the kids rush to redecorate their parent's bedroom before Gil and Kelly Jo get back.

Thursday, June 18 at 9 p.m. EDT "Bringing Up Bates" Episode 203 - "High Risk, High Hopes" Erin and Chad meet with Dr. Vick to discuss the risk of having a stillbirth and the precautions they must take for the rest of her pregnancy. Later, the couple invites Zach, Whitney and baby Bradley over for dinner while the older boys square off against the younger ones in a giant game of capture the fort!

Thursday, June 25 at 9 p.m. EDT "Bringing Up Bates" Episode 204 - "Meema Moves In" Gil and Kelly Jo take Trace and Josie to the orthodontist to get braces, and Gil reveals how he can afford orthodontia for so many kids. Later, Kelly Jo's mother Meema announces that she wants to live closer to the kids. So Kelly Jo takes her house hunting, but the task proves tougher than anyone could have imagined.

Led by devoted father Gil (50) and his loving wife Kelly Jo (48), the Bates do everything in bulk, while staying true to their core values and rules for the family - which means that everyone has chores, watches DVDs and classic programming rather than TV, the girls only wear dresses and more. With a grand total of 19 children ranging in age from 3 to 26, they are the definition of a "big, happy family." But lately - as viewers will see - their simple rural lifestyle in Tennessee is in a flurry of transitions and is continually challenged by the modern world. The hit UP Original Series continues this season to explore new, ever-changing family dynamics. This abundant family continues to have bigger drama, bigger challenges and bigger life events to celebrate in the UP Original Series "Bringing Up Bates."
